Couple of comments:
1. That is definitely factory sealed. Dreamcast seals aren't great which is why some are looser than others, but I can tell by the folds that is a factory seal.
2. This doesn't excuse misrepresentation but $55 for a sealed Power Stone is a great deal (even with the crack and residue), so I really wouldn't be that upset about the whole thing.
3. There were no pictures on the auction so as they say "buyer beware". I tend not buy on ebay without pics because you never know what you will get.
4. You can always sell it for more than you paid.
5. Not everyone are sealed collectors like us, so to non-collectors "sealed in perfect condition" can mean exactly what you received. In reality, it's not that bad. I've seen (and have) much worse.

People here have suggested using "Goo Gone" to get rid of residue. I have not tried it myself as I am afraid to use any kind of cleaning products on plastic. I typically just use a piece of scotch tape and try to pull off the residue. It usually works, you just have to be careful not to pull off the wrap
